A deliberately small practice of senior people

Senior people lead every engagement and stay on it. No layers between you and the people doing the work. It is also how alignment survives: the people who built the agreement are the people who see it through.

Sage began in 2019 and was incorporated as a company in 2021, on a simple premise: that the regulated systems people depend on, for their care, their money, and their safety, deserve advice that reconciles competing interests rather than serving one of them.

Across our careers we have led enterprise transformation spanning financial services, federal and state government reform, airlines, aged care, and social services, including national reform in carer support. We bring that depth to a focused number of engagements at a time, which is how we keep senior people on every piece of work.

Human services is our deepest specialism, grounded in biopsychosocial models of health and wellbeing. We are an NHMRC Eligible Organisation, can lead research-grade work in our own right, and partner with universities and tertiary institutions to translate their research into action that holds up in practice.
